Batman v Superman Box Office Numbers Take a Hit

Though Warner Bros.‘Batman v Superman: Dawn of Justiceundeniably had a huge opening weekend at the box office, it seems as if early estimates were slightly over-eager. Weekend estimates had the domestic tally at $170.1 million and a global total of $424.1 million. Those numbers were enough to putZack Snyder’sfilm in the top spot by far for the domestic box office race, as well as making it the biggest opening for: a DC Comics film, Snyder himself, movies opening in 2016 (beating outDeadpool), as well as the biggest openings ever for March, Spring, and Easter weekend....

Gemini Man Review: Ang Lee Made You a Tech Demo

Gemini Mancould very well be directorAng Lee’s worst movie. I can’t say for certain because there are a few I haven’t seen, but at the very least, it’s a far cry from when the director cared about making movies about people. Even his misbegottenHulkadaptation is concerned with a tortured father-son relationship as much as its CGI superhero. But that kind of care is nowhere to be found in the bland and genericGemini Man, a movie that avoids all of its interesting ideas about identity and legacy in favor ofWill Smithfighting a younger CGI version of Will Smith whose appearance ranges from convincing to cartoony....
